Chemical Identifiers

CAS 7791-13-1
Molecular Formula Cl2CoH12O6
Molecular Weight (g/mol) 237.92
MDL Number MFCD00149652
InChI Key GFHNAMRJFCEERV-UHFFFAOYSA-L
Synonym Cobalt (II) Chloride
IUPAC Name λ²-cobalt(2+) hexahydrate dichloride
SMILES O.O.O.O.O.O.[Cl-].[Cl-].[Co++]

Hazard Category Signal Word: DANGER!
Hazard Statement DANGER!
Precautionary Statement Emergency Overview
Possible cancer hazard. May cause cancer based on animal data. May cause cancer by inhalation. Harmful if swallowed. Irritating to eyes, respiratory system and skin. May cause allergic respiratory and skin reaction. May impair fertility. Possible risks of irreversible effects. Very toxic to aquatic organisms, may cause long-term adverse effects in the aquatic environment.
